After starring on 33 covers of British Vogue since her debut in 1993 you would think Kate Moss would have achieved enough with the publication. She is now set to become a British Vogue magazine contributing fashion editor. Her first story is due to feature in the forthcoming spring issue.

No doubt she is more than qualified and will bring her wealth of knowledge and experience in the industry to the magazine.

“We are absolutely thrilled at Kate’s appointment,” said Sarah Doukas, founder of Storm Models, which represents Moss. “This is a natural development in her remarkable career. Bringing her unique sense of style and creative sensibility to Vogue is the perfect fit. She is the definitive Vogue cover girl.”

From her collaborations with Topshop and Mango to being a beauty ambassador with Rimmel London with her own range of lipsticks with them; everything she touches turns to gold and British Vogue will be no exception.

After the success of her first collaboration with Topshop from 2007-2010 Moss will now design a new collection to be sold in 40 countries in 2014.

“I have really missed being involved in the design process, and working with the team at Topshop. Now more than ever, with London being at the forefront of fashion it feels like I’m back home working with Topshop,” said Moss.

“I am absolutely delighted that Kate is going to work with us in this new role,” Alexandra Shulman, editor-in-chief of the magazine said. “Her undoubtedly brilliant sense of style, depth of fashion knowledge and understanding of what makes a wonderful image will be exciting to see on the pages of BritishVogue. I am really looking forward to working with her on ideas.”
